Abstract;Operation efficiency measurements and subjective evaluation were carried out for the same tasks on hardcopy and various kind of displays, as a first step to know the difference on human-interface between hardcopy and softcopy. Simple tasks were given to 25 persons as subjects on hardcopy and displays. Answer speed and correct answer rate was measured for objective evaluation. Questionnaires on viewing easiness and degree of fatigue were given to the subjects for subjective evaluation. The objective evaluation showed only slight difference between various working styles; on the other hand the subjective evaluation showed prominent superiority of hardcopy work to the other various display work groups.
